File Coverage

blib/lib/ODS/Serialize/YAML.pm
Criterion Covered Total %
statement 10 10 100.0
branch n/a
condition n/a
subroutine 4 4 100.0
pod 0 2 0.0
total 14 16 87.5


line stmt bran cond sub pod time code
1             package ODS::Serialize::YAML;
2              
3 71     71   553 use YAOO;
  71         200  
  71         474  
4              
5 71     71   59639 use YAML::XS;
  71         215805  
  71         8928  
6              
7             has file_suffix => isa(string('yml'));
8              
9             sub parse {
10 72     72 0 790 my ($self, $data) = @_;
11 72         23132 return Load $data;
12             }
13              
14             sub stringify {
15 1764     1764 0 22489 my ($self, $data) = @_;
16 1764         310735 return Dump $data;
17             }
18              
19             1;